The Lethal Shoving of Vicha Ratanapakdee
In 2021, Vicha Ratanapakdee, an 84-year old Thai American man, was killed after being forcefully pushed to the ground in the middle of the day in San Francisco, California. Asad and Saadia share the story.

A Hate Crime in Sydney
Scott Johnson's death in 1988 was initially treated as a suicide by Austrailian police. But in 2007, an investigation revealed he died because of a gay-hate attack. Asad and Saadia share the story.

Murders in Medford
In December 1987, the bodies of two women were found in the back of a pickup truck. They had been bound, gagged and shot in the head. Their bodies were wrapped in drapes and covered in cardboard boxes. Saadia and Asad share the story.

Invisible Hate shines a spotlight on the hidden world of hate crimes in America—acts fueled by race, religion, sexual orientation, and other biases that too often go unreported and unpunished. Hosts Saadia Khan, a human rights advocate and social entrepreneur, and Asad Butt, journalist and founder of Rifelion Media, dig deep into these overlooked incidents, asking the pressing question: Why does the system ignore so many hate crimes? Each episode examines a specific case, analyzing its details and uncovering the social and legal challenges that affect its classification as a hate crime.
